    • Reporting on the latest advancements in digital twin technology, researchers have developed a unified construction method for radio environment knowledge (REK) to enhance the accuracy of digital twin channels (DTC) in 6G wireless networks. This innovation simplifies the complex relationship between environmental factors and electromagnetic wave propagation, significantly reducing network complexity.
